Why Can't I Send Any Emails?

Troubleshoot why you are unable to send emails.

Gmail API Error

Sometimes when you try to send an email through LeadSimple, you may run into the error "Error encountered when sending using Gmail API". 

This error is an issue caused by Gmail with connected gmail accounts. We are currently (as of July 2019) in contact with them and are working to get this resolved. 

You may find that it is an intermittent problem. If it persists, contact us at support@leadsimple.com. Remember that you can always email leads inside your gmail inbox and those emails will be matched to the lead in the system.


PERMISSION_DENIED: Request had insufficient authentication scopes

You might encounter this error when the first time you connected your email you didn’t give Lead Simple enough permissions. To fix this, all you need to do is re-connect your email and check all the boxes on the Gmail page when you connect your account.

Access Denied Error

When you try to send an email through LeadSimple, you may sometimes encounter an error that says "Access Denied: You need to reconnect your email account".

This means that your email account has become disconnected from LeadSimple so the software can't send emails from that email address until you reconnect it. 

Reconnecting Your Email
First, go to your profile page by clicking your name in the top left.

Scroll down to Email Accounts and find your disconnected email account.

Next, click "Reconnect" next to the email account. You may be prompted to provide additional information so simply follow them when they appear.
